“Revenge of the Nerds” sees two lovable nerds, Gilbert Lowell (Anthony Edwards) and Lewis Skolnick (Robert Carradine) on their way to the first year of Adam’s College. When they arrive both friends are made the center of jokes and pranks from the jocks of Alpha Beta fraternity. This doesn’t improve their image. When the jocks accidentally burn down their own fraternity, they’re off to take over the nerd’s dormitory. In self-defense, the nerds form their own fraternity anywhere they can establish themselves. Making matters worse, Gilbert develops a uncontrolled crush on Betty Childes (Julia Montgomery) a popular sorority sister and girlfriend to the main jock, Stan Gable (Ted McGinley). But in a last ditch effort to make a difference and win affection and hearts of their fellow peers the nerds fight back the only way they know how by outsmarting the jocks.
